Nellie Burns and Moonshine Mystery

Step into the roaring 1920s with a bold photographer as she seeks adventure and a career in the American West. Each installment plunges her into a new locale, unearthing thrilling mysteries and dangerous intrigues that challenge her sharp wit and observational skills. Often clashing with local law enforcement, she uses her camera and intellect to chase down the truth behind perplexing crimes. This series offers a compelling narrative of a woman forging her own path through a rugged world filled with secrets, revenge, and loss.

Recommended Reading Order

    Moonshadows

    • 303 pages
    • 11 hours of reading
    3.9(30)Add rating

    In the early 1920s, photographer Nellie Burns leaves Chicago to find adventure and a career in the West. She lands in Ketchum, Idaho. Out one night photographing moonshadows on snow, she discovers and photographs a dead body. When the body disappears and her negatives are stolen, she joins the chase to solve the mystery and find her negatives. But the Basque sheriff does not welcome her help, and the Chinese residents in town suspect Nellie herself of murder. As Nellie unravels the mystery of the missing body, she encounters a tangled web of revenge, opium addiction, obsessive love and loss, and a haunting story of devotion.

    Nellie Burns, photographer, and her Labrador dog, Moonshine, travel with sheep rancher Gwynn Campbell and his Basque sheepherder to the Stanley Basin of central Idaho. Nellie plans to photograph scenes for a railroad's brochures to lure tourists to the West. When they arrive at the sheep camp, they discover the current herder is dead. Nellie's curiosity and photography lead her to a moonshine still and then a dash up a forested mountain. Nellie and Moonshine confront the greatest challenges yet to their courage and ingenuity when they face a range war and a ruthless killer. Basque Moon is an exciting and authentic story of western conflicts in the 1920s. Nellie must dig deep to restore her faith in herself and her chosen profession.

    Moonscape

    • 377 pages
    • 14 hours of reading

    A WILLA Award-Winning AuthorA Nellie Burns and Moonshine MysteryIn the Craters of the Moon in southwest Idaho, where three people are missing, Nellie Burns accompanies Sheriff Asteguigoiri to the lava fields as his photographer. Marked on maps as "unexplored" and "unknown," the miles of lava resist easy navigation and Nell's photography. Rosy Kipling, the one-eyed miner and Nell's friend, is recruited to assist in the search amidst concerns about a religious cult and money related to the missing. Physical obstacles, secrets and lies, and consuming greed endanger all. And alone, Nell faces an attempt on her sanity and her life in this remote and almost inaccessible natural phenomenon.
